In the United Kingdom, employers are required to adhere to strict laws and regulations when it comes to managing their workforce From recruitment and hiring to employee relations and termination, there are numerous legal issues that can arise in the workplace This is where HR legal support becomes crucial for businesses operating in the UK.
HR legal support refers to the guidance and expertise provided by human resources professionals who are well-versed in employment laws and regulations These professionals work to ensure that businesses are in compliance with the law and are equipped to handle any legal challenges that may arise in the workplace In the UK, there are a number of laws that employers must abide by, including those related to discrimination, harassment, privacy, and health and safety Failing to comply with these laws can result in hefty fines and legal consequences for businesses.
One of the key roles of HR legal support in the UK is to help businesses navigate the complex landscape of employment laws and regulations This includes staying up to date on changes to existing laws and ensuring that businesses are in compliance with all legal requirements HR legal professionals can help businesses draft employee handbooks, create policies and procedures, and provide training on legal issues such as discrimination and harassment They can also offer guidance on how to handle employee grievances, investigations, and disciplinary actions in compliance with the law.
